Which medal is awarded by the President, in the name of Congress, to members of the Naval service who conspicuously distinguish themselves by gallantry and intrepidity at the risk of their lives above and beyond the call of duty?

a) Bronze Star Medal
b) Navy Cross
c) Silver Star Medal
d) Medal of Honor

Final answer:

The Medal of Honor is the medal awarded by the President, in the name of Congress, to members of the Naval service who conspicuously distinguish themselves by gallantry and intrepidity at the risk of their lives above and beyond the call of duty.

Step-by-step explanation:

The medal awarded by the President, in the name of Congress, to members of the Naval service who conspicuously distinguish themselves by gallantry and intrepidity at the risk of their lives above and beyond the call of duty is the Medal of Honor (d).

This is the highest military decoration that can be awarded to members of the United States Armed Forces. It is presented for acts of valor that go beyond the normal call of duty, and it is awarded by the President on behalf of Congress.
